Overview
At $41.99, the Indi IBKB4100 is one of the more expensive single-bottle options in the category, placing it firmly in premium territory. The 4.4-star rating from 236 reviewers is a positive early signal, though 236 ratings is still a modest sample at this price point. Buyers spending this much on a single bottle reasonably expect more detailed specification data and a larger review pool to validate the investment.
The bottle weighs 10.1 ounces, which is noticeably heavier than many standard plastic baby bottles. That extra weight could reflect glass construction, a thick-walled silicone body, or a substantial design with a protective sleeve, all of which are features associated with premium bottle categories. Without explicit material confirmation in the listing, the weight is the clearest proxy for what distinguishes this bottle from lighter, less expensive alternatives.
Premium baby bottles at this price range typically justify the cost through features such as advanced anti-colic venting, ease of assembly, durable materials, and a minimalist part count that simplifies cleaning. Whether the Indi IBKB4100 delivers on those attributes would be best confirmed by reading individual owner reviews on the current Amazon listing, where detail-oriented parents tend to describe exactly what they received for their money.

Performance notes
The 10.1-ounce weight is notable. Standard BPA-free plastic bottles typically weigh considerably less, so this figure suggests a denser material, possibly borosilicate glass, silicone, or a glass bottle with a silicone protective sleeve. These materials are more durable through drops and repeated sterilization cycles than standard plastic. At 236 reviews and 4.4 stars, owners have not flagged widespread quality issues, but the review base is not yet large enough to draw firm conclusions about long-term durability or nipple performance across different baby ages.

Is $41.99 a typical price for a premium baby bottle?
Yes, premium baby bottles, particularly glass ones with protective sleeves or bottles with specialized anti-colic venting systems, commonly range from $25 to $50 or more for a single unit. The value proposition at this price typically includes more durable materials, fewer replacement parts, and features specifically designed to reduce gas and colic. Whether the Indi IBKB4100 delivers those features is best confirmed by reading detailed owner reviews.
